logo

Output 109b40d5ef83148241943642e366e3c289e03c1ce990e9cf5876f796c527d7bb:1

value
3333038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0215c9f25aa6f5c8b2e52b61675e14068b7ea1ce OP_EQUAL
address
31t3NqsxY3FhcVRYkjbKqjpEFyqE8TYDuT
transaction
109b40d5ef83148241943642e366e3c289e03c1ce990e9cf5876f796c527d7bb